利用Redis实现跨进程数据共享(redis跨进程数据访问)
Redis是一个开源、高性能的分布式内存数据库,它既可以用于缓存、也可以用于跨进程数据共享。Redis实现跨进程数据共享的好处是可以最大程度地减少在数据共享上的内存耗费,有效地提升应用的性能。
如何利用Redis实现跨进程数据共享呢?具体步骤如下:
## 一、安装Redis
在使用Redis之前需要先安装Redis。我们可以从官网上下载最新版本的Redis,然后根据具体环境下的需要完成Redis的安装配置工作。
## 二、配置需要共享的数据格式
在Redis中,数据可以使用不同的格式存储,如普通的字符串、列表等。需要根据具体的需求来确定要共享的数据的格式。
## 三、设置数据到Redis
完成了安装和配置工作后,我们就可以使用Redis来存储需要共享的数据了。可以使用`SET`命令将数据存储到Redis中,也可以使用` HMSET`、 `MSET`等命令进行多个数据的存储。
## 四、获取共享的数据
设置完数据以后,很重要的一步就是能够正确地获取这些数据了。最常用的获取数据的命令就是`GET`,可以使用该命令来获取单个数据;如果需要获取多个数据,则可以使用`MGET`命令。
SET key value
HMSET key field1 value1 field2 value2 ...
MSET key1 value1 key2 value2 ...
GET key
MGET key1 key2 ...
以上就是使用Redis实现跨进程数据共享的步骤,它可以帮助我们有效地提升系统的性能,更加高效地共享数据。